Kwara State to Benefit from $45 Million EU-UNICEF Health Programme
Kwara State, located in North Central Nigeria, has been selected as one of the three states to benefit from the implementation of a $45 million EU-UNICEF programme in Nigeria, as reported by Voice of Nigeria.
The project, according to the state Commissioner for Health, Dr. Aminat Ahmed El-Imam, is tagged the “Strengthening Access to Reproductive and Adolescent Health (SARAH) project.” She stated that this initiative is part of the efforts of the state Governor,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q, in the health sector.
Dr. El-Imam disclosed that the SARAH project would improve the health and well-being of the state's citizens by addressing reproductive, maternal, newborn, and child health and nutrition challenges.

The $45 million SARAH project will be implemented across Adamawa, Kwara and Sokoto states in Nigeria.
